1. What is the Length of Wire of Spring Formula?

The formula calculates the total length of wire required to create a helical spring, based on the mean radius of the spring coil and the number of coils. This is essential for manufacturing and design purposes in mechanical engineering.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 L_{wire} = 2 \times \pi \times R \times N \]

Where:

Explanation: The formula multiplies the circumference of one coil (2πR) by the number of coils (N) to determine the total wire length.

5. Frequently Asked Questions (FAQ)

Q1: Why is the mean radius used instead of outer or inner radius?
A: The mean radius provides the most accurate representation of the coil's centerline, which is where the wire length is measured.

Q2: Does this formula account for wire thickness?
A: No, this formula assumes the wire thickness is negligible compared to the coil radius. For precise calculations with thick wire, additional adjustments may be needed.

Q3: Can this formula be used for non-helical springs?
A: No, this formula is specifically designed for helical springs. Other spring types require different calculation methods.

Q4: How accurate is this calculation for real-world applications?
A: The formula provides a good estimate for most engineering purposes, though manufacturing tolerances and material properties may cause slight variations.
